How Can I Get a Job as a Script Writer s Assistant?

To get a job as a script writer assistant, you typically need a passion for or background in entertainment or media and a degree in a relevant field. Many employers list the minimum educational qualifications of a bachelor’s degree in journalism, English, media studies, communications, or a similar area. However, having sufficient experience in TV or film production, executive assistant jobs, or editorial roles may suffice if you don’t have a degree. It’s essential to have exceptional communication and writing skills, the ability to take notes quickly and accurately, a strong command of the English language and grammar and spelling conventions, and a strong work ethic.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Script Writer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Script Writer Assistant, you need strong writing, editing, and research skills, often supported by a background in communications, film, or creative writing. Familiarity with script formatting software like Final Draft and proficiency in collaborative tools such as Google Workspace are typically required. Attention to detail, creativity, and excellent organizational abilities help you support writers and manage script revisions effectively. These skills ensure the smooth development and production of high-quality scripts in fast-paced creative environments.

What are some common challenges Script Writer Assistants face when supporting writers throughout the script development process?

Script Writer Assistants often encounter challenges such as managing multiple drafts and revisions under tight deadlines, ensuring continuity and accuracy in script formatting, and effectively communicating feedback between writers and production teams. They must stay organized to track script changes and maintain detailed notes, while also adapting quickly to evolving creative directions. Collaboration skills are essential, as Script Writer Assistants frequently coordinate with writers, editors, and production staff to facilitate a smooth workflow.

What are Script Writer Assistants?

Script Writer Assistants are professionals who support script writers in the development and organization of scripts for television, film, theater, or digital media. Their duties often include conducting research, formatting scripts, proofreading, managing revisions, and sometimes helping generate ideas or dialogue. They play a vital role in ensuring the scriptwriting process runs smoothly by handling administrative tasks and maintaining communication between writers and other production staff. Script Writer Assistants help writers stay organized and focused on the creative aspects of their work.

Your Role...
Provides administrative support to the EVP, Production and SVP, Creative Development at DC Studios.
Your Role Responsibilities...
  • Arranges executive calendar and schedules meetings, independently or as directed.
  • Coordinates/arranges domestic & international travel and hotel accommodations for executives, writers, directors, and producers.
  • Requests and tracks script coverage for upcoming material.
  • Maintains scripts and phone logs, as well as various files, records, indexes, reports, schedules, and matrixes.
  • Creates and maintains schedules.
  • Coordinates information for writer/director lists.
  • Exercise discretion and act as gatekeeper filtering incoming calls and screening incoming emails and information
  • Prepares expense reports and travel authorizations and follows through.
  • Regularly correspond with networks, studios, talent, agents, managers, producers, etc. on behalf of EVP and SVP.
  • Greets clients, talent, creative staff, and executives.
  • Performs other related duties and projects as assigned

Qualifications and Experience...
  • Minimum 2-year previous assistant experience.
  • Previous experience in motion picture or television creative development at a studio or production company.
  • College degree required.
  • Requires a valid driver's license and reliable transportation.
  • Typing skills with pro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, PC and MAC required.
  • Ability to communicate effectively and tactfully with persons on all levels, in person and on the phone.
  • Ability to pay close attention to detail and understand written and oral instructions.
  • Ability to handle multiple tasks, organize, prioritize, and schedule work effectively.
  • Ability to be proactive and flexible, personable, and able to interact with all levels of personnel.
  • Ability to work overtime and on flexible time zones, as needed.
  • Position requires full-time, in-office presence in Burbank (5 days/week).
  • Familiarity with agents/agencies, producers, and film and television community in general
  • Working knowledge of Feature Writers and Directors strongly desired.
  • Strong interest in scripts and general film and television knowledge preferred.
